Build the foundations for successful functional safety. We help organisations establish governance frameworks, lifecycle plans, responsibilities and supporting processes that enable consistent, compliant and well-managed outcomes throughout the lifecycle.
Develop and assess the skills, knowledge and experience required to fulfil functional safety responsibilities. We support competency frameworks, role assessments and capability development across engineering, operations and management teams.
Identify hazards, assess risk and establish the basis for effective risk reduction. Structured studies help teams understand credible hazardous events, evaluate safeguards and make informed decisions throughout design, operation and modification.
Address the challenges of modern automation. We apply system-theoretic approaches to identify unsafe interactions, control deficiencies and emergent risks within autonomous, remote and highly automated systems.
Translate risk reduction objectives into clear and auditable requirements. We develop safety requirements specifications that define the functional, integrity and performance expectations of safety-related systems.
Determine the level of integrity required to achieve tolerable risk. We support SIL determination and allocation using recognised methodologies and industry good practice to establish appropriate safety targets.
Assess safety-related system and process designs to identify failure modes, challenge assumptions, and support the achievement of safety, reliability and performance objectives.
Provide confidence that safety requirements have been correctly implemented. We review designs, calculations and supporting evidence to confirm alignment with project objectives, standards and safety requirements.
Demonstrate that safety functions perform as intended in the real world. We support testing, commissioning and operational acceptance activities to confirm that safety objectives have been achieved.
Deliver independent assessments, compliance audits and practical training that strengthen capability, support continual improvement and build confidence in both systems and safety processes.
